Violet Bode, 87, formerly of Belmond, died March 3, 2007 at USA Health Care Center in Clarion. Services were held March 7 at the Belmond United Methodist Church with Pastor Mike Druhl officiating. Burial was at the Belmond Cemetery. Violet was born March 17, 1919 in Belmond to Thomas and Elsie May (Ainger) Harty. She was raised and attended school in the Belmond area. Violet married Darwin Glen Bode on June 4, 1935 in Algona. Violet enjoyed playing pinochle, cooking, fishing, crocheting and reading. She was an excellent cook and worked at the Sundowner in Clarion.

She was preceded in death by her parents; husband Darwin; daughter Audrey Darlene; son Ray Bode; granddaughters Janese and LaDonna; grandson David; great granddaughter Angel Mae; great-great grandson Spencer Hansen; brothers Lester, Ray, Maynard and Cleatis; and sister Marie. Violet is survived by children Ellen (Dale) Brobst of Necedah, WI, Dan Bode of Goldfield, Cindy Espeseth of Apache Junction, AZ, LuCretia Bartels of Necedah, and Kaye Roelofsen and special friend Robert Piekarski of Algona; thirty-one grandchildren; fifty-eight great grandchildren; and many great-great grandchildren.

Belmond Independent
March 15, 2007
